Minneapolis lies on both banks of the Mississippi River, just north of the river’s confluence with the Minnesota River, and adjoins Saint Paul, the state’s capital.The name “Minneapolis”, meaning “Water City” in a mash-up of the Dakota word minne for water, and the Ancient Greek word polis for city. The motto “City of Lakes” refers to the city’s 22 natural lakes within city limits.
